Hermes 2 Advanced: A Adaptable AI Assistant
Model Overview
Hermes 2 Advanced, originating from the Llama-3 8B framework, is an advanced version of the original Hermes 2. It has been revised with an refreshed and cleaned OpenHermes 2.5 Dataset and incorporates new Function Execution and JSON Mode datasets built in-house. This platform excels at common tasks, interaction abilities, and is notably competent in function calling and structured JSON outputs.

Core Attributes
Function Calling and JSON Outputs: Hermes 2 Advanced achieves a 90% on function calling evaluation and 84% on JSON response evaluation. This renders it extremely dependable for operations needing these precise responses.
Exclusive Tokens: The model incorporates special tokens for agent abilities, boosting its parsing while managing tokens.
ChatML Prompt Format: Hermes 2 Advanced leverages the ChatML structure, analogous to OpenAI's, which allows for formatted multi-turn exchanges.

OpenChat System: Advancing Open-source AI Models
Model Description
OpenChat Model, originating from the Llama-3-Instruct model, offers a robust platform for code generation, interactive sessions, and common tasks. The system is created to excel in different benchmarks, establishing it as a leading player in the open-source AI landscape.

Core Attributes
High Performance: OpenChat Model platforms are optimized for efficient operation and can perform efficiently on standard GPUs with 24GB RAM.
Integration with OpenAI: The server responds for calls congruent with OpenAI ChatCompletion API specifications, making incorporation simple for programmers comfortable with OpenAI tools.
Versatile Templates: OpenChat offers ready-made and personalized templates, augmenting its usability for different tasks.

Featherless.ai: Accessing Hugging Face Models
Service Summary
Featherless Platform seeks to streamline access to a comprehensive range of AI models from Hugging Face. It confronts the difficulties of downloading and deploying big models on GPUs, granting a economical and user-friendly service.

Core Attributes
Extensive Model Access: Clients can execute over 450 Hugging Face models with a basic subscription.
Custom Inference Infrastructure: Featherless.ai System employs a uniquely developed inference framework that dynamically adjusts in response to model popularity, securing smooth resource use.
Security of Data: The service highlights data security and data protection, with no storing of user inputs and outputs.
